How to Say “Captain” in Spanish

Introduction

If you’re interested in knowing how to say “captain” in Spanish or referring to a captain in a Spanish-speaking context, it’s important to understand the various translations and terms used. In this article, we will explore different ways to say “captain” in Spanish, providing you with the necessary vocabulary to accurately convey the title or refer to someone with that role.

1. Capitán

The most common and straightforward translation for “captain” in Spanish is “capitán.” This term is widely used in Spanish-speaking countries to refer to a person who holds the rank of captain in various fields, such as the military, aviation, or maritime industries.Example:El capitán del barco guió a la tripulación durante la travesía. (The captain of the ship guided the crew during the voyage.)

2. Comandante

In some contexts, the term “comandante” can be used interchangeably with “capitán” to refer to a captain. However, “comandante” is more commonly associated with the military or aviation, specifically in the sense of a commanding officer.Example:El comandante del escuadrón dirigió la operación con éxito. (The squadron commander led the operation successfully.)

3. Capitana

To specifically refer to a female captain, the term “capitana” is used. This term adds a feminine ending (-a) to the word “capitán” to indicate a female holding the rank of captain.Example:La capitana del equipo lideró con determinación y habilidad. (The captain of the team led with determination and skill.)

4. Jefe

In some informal or colloquial contexts, the term “jefe” can be used to refer to a captain, particularly in a leadership role. While “jefe” translates to “boss” or “chief” in English, it can also be used more broadly to refer to a captain or someone in charge.Example:Nuestro jefe de equipo es un gran capitán. (Our team leader is a great captain.)

5. Patrón

In the maritime and boating context, particularly in smaller vessels or recreational settings, the term “patrón” can be used to refer to the person in charge or captain of the boat. It is commonly used in Spain and other Spanish-speaking regions with a strong maritime culture.Example:El patrón del barco aseguró que todos los pasajeros estuvieran a salvo. (The boat captain ensured that all passengers were safe.)

Conclusion

When it comes to translating or referring to the title “captain” in Spanish, there are several options to consider. The most common translation is “capitán,” which is widely used across various fields. “Comandante” can also be used, particularly in military or aviation contexts. To refer to a female captain, “capitana” is used. In some informal contexts, “jefe” can be used to refer to a captain or someone in charge. In maritime settings, “patrón” is used to refer to the captain of a boat. By understanding these different terms, you’ll be able to accurately convey the title or refer to a captain in a Spanish-speaking context.
